Covered electrode for Heterogeneous Welding
of Cast Iron

Application and Properties: |
Electrode having a nickel core wire,
for hot and cold welding on grey cast iron, suitable for welding
joints as well as for surfacing. Suitable to use in repair of machine
frames, machine housings, machine parts and bearing blocks. The
electrode has a very soft, regular fusion, and a quiet and steady
arc. It is well suited for positional welding. Very little dilution
with the parent metal takes place, resulting in good machinability
of the transition area. Preferably is used with DCEN but possible
to use with also AC.
